The charge relaxation rate c of intermediate-valence compounds is identified experimentally by the different behavior of the phonon-mode frequencies for >>c and c. This classification yields a systematic understanding of the occurrence or absence of phonon anomalies in all intermediate-valence compounds investigated so far. A temperature dependence of c could be determined in the case of Sm0.75Y0.25S. © 1986 The American Physical Society.
